Swiss chard stems moutabbal/Dip

Suitable for #vegan An easy way to cook the stems of the chard. We usually make it in Lebanon along with swiss chard pies as a dip. It’s similar to baba gannouj but quicker and easier to make. #easyrecipe #Lebanesefood #seasonsupply

Cooking instructions

* Step 1

Boil the stems for 10 minutes (i had rainbow chard which was amazing to add some colors to the dish 🌈)
Image step 1

* Step 2

Drain the cooked stems, rinse with cold water and move to the blender. Add the other ingredients and mix for a few seconds
Image step 2

* Step 3

I prefer not to over blend it because i love the small bits of the chard

* Step 4

Top with olive oil and enjoy it!
